About Google Forms
• Google Forms, another product from Google, is an app to create web based
forms/questionnaire and collect answers online in real-time. Can be used in any
device: smartphone, laptop/PC and tablet.
• As a platform, Google Forms can be used for practically any online data gathering
activities, from using a simple form to complex questionnaire. Google Forms is as
useful for students doing school projects as for professionals for company projects.
• Teachers/educators would love the scoring feature for each question based on
its answer that enables Google Forms to be a quiz/test tool.
• Our years of experience using Google Forms as survey tool shows that Google
Forms is solid; reliable and secure app, during questionnaire development and data
collection. The forms/questionnaire also looks professional.
• Google Forms is Free.

Interest to Buy a New Smartphone
• For this tutorial, we have developed questionnaire titled “Interest to Buy a New
Smartphone”
• The objective of the questionnaire is to understand consumer interest to buy for a
new smartphone
• For respondents to have better knowledge of the product, we need to show
picture of the phone, video and its specification in the questionnaire.
• We measure the interest to buy at the price at which it is going to be sold
• Understand the changes in interest to buy when price is increased/lowered
• As background to the finding, we want to understand smartphone brand
awareness, brand image and ownership.

Linear Scale
We select Linear Scale because we want respondent to give a score, a number between assigned range. It is
usually used for evaluation about product or service. The lowest and highest number in the range can have labels
to help respondent in giving score.

Paragraph
• When we ask question and expect the answer to be in long text, select Paragraph. In questionnaire usually the
paragraph question type is related to why/reasoning questions where answer can be quite long and unstructured.
•Another example of question that answers in long text is for writing list of items.

Multiple Data in a Single Cell Problem
Checkbox question, can have one Paragraph question, respondents
Hypothetical data from or more than one answer can answer as they wish
example questionnaire.
One cell contains answer
from particular question
and respondent. Please
note that answers for
some questions almost
all cells contain multiple
data
Data in a cell is treated as one single data
